Barbadian Dollar

The Barbadian Dollar (BBD) is the official currency of Barbados, used for all monetary transactions within the country.

History/Origin

Introduced in 1973, replacing the Barbadian Pound, the Barbadian Dollar was initially pegged to the British Pound and later to the US Dollar, maintaining stability through various monetary policies.

Current Use

The BBD is widely used in Barbados for everyday transactions, banking, and trade, and is pegged to the US Dollar at a fixed rate of 2 BBD to 1 USD.


Mexican Peso

The Mexican Peso (MXN) is the official currency of Mexico, used for everyday transactions and financial exchanges within the country.

History/Origin

The Mexican Peso originated in the 19th century, evolving from the Spanish dollar and undergoing various reforms. It was decimalized in 1905 and has experienced multiple currency reforms, including the introduction of the current peso in 1993 to stabilize the economy.

Current Use

Today, the Mexican Peso is widely used in Mexico for all forms of payment, both cash and electronic, and is one of the most traded currencies in Latin America.
